Kokrajhar: The Returning Officer (RO) of 5- Kokrajhar (ST) HP constituency has issued election notification for the Constituency today.
The notice mentioned that nomination papers may be delivered by a candidate or any of his/her proposers to the Returning Officer Partha Pratim Mazumdar or to Assistant Returning Officer Sanjeev Kr. Sharma at the office chamber of the Deputy Commissioner, Kokrajhar between 11 AM and 3 PM on any day (other than public holidays) not later than the April 4.
The nomination forms can be obtained from the office of the Returning Officer and Deputy Commissioner, Kokrajhar and the nomination papers will be taken for scrutiny at 11AM of April 5 at the said office as well.
It is also informed that notice of withdrawal of candidature may be delivered either by a candidate or by any of his/her proposers or by his/her election agent who has been authorised by the candidate at the office of the Returning Officer, 5- Kokrajhar (ST) Parliamentary Constituency before 3 PM of April 8. It further notified that the poll will take place on April 23 between 7 AM and 5 PM.
The Returning Officer, 5- Kokrajhar (ST) HPC and Deputy Commissioner, Kokrajhar Partha Pratim Mazumdar also held an elaborate meeting with political parties and election related officials. The meeting was attended by the representatives of registered central and state political parties like Congress (I), CPI (M), BJP and BPF.
The Returning Officer cum Deputy Commissioner briefed on the Model Code of Conduct, Election Expenditure Monitoring mechanism, nomination process and new facilities introduced by the Election Commission of India for voters like Suvidha, cVisil, 24×7 telephone service for complain related matters and toll free number 1950. He advised all parties to follow the rules and guidelines laid down by the ECI and appealed to all political parties to maintain peace and communal harmony during and after the elections in the district.
The Returning Officer and Deputy Commissioner also advised all political parties to have a knowledge of the processes, required paperwork to be filed, restrictions etc. during the elections, so that they don’t face any hurdles and difficulties.
In the meeting, Kokrajhar Election Officer informed that there were about 1,80,947 voters in 30- Kokrajhar East (ST) LAC and they will cast their votes in 245 polling stations at 157 locations.
Meanwhile 10 aspirants have taken nomination papers today.
